RICHFIELD – Dakota Robinson scored 14 points and pulled down five rebounds in leading Enterprise to a 43-28 win over North Sevier in the 2A girls basketball state championship game Saturday night.

Enterprise led 22-11 at the half and wasn't threatened in the second half on its way to the title. Enterprise held North Sevier to just 28.9 percent shooting.

Jaycee Reber had 13 points and Riley Lyman had six points and five rebounds for Enterprise, while Hailey Higgs led North Sevier with six points in the loss.

Enterprise knocked off a No. 1 seed, No. 2 seed and two No. 3 seeds to win its seventh title in school history and first since 2011.
